The 1N4005GPHM3/54 belongs to the category of rectifier diodes.
It is commonly used in electronic circuits for converting alternating current (AC) to direct current (DC).
The 1N4005GPHM3/54 has two pins, anode, and cathode. The anode is connected to the positive terminal of the circuit, while the cathode is connected to the negative terminal.
The 1N4005GPHM3/54 operates based on the principle of semiconductor rectification. When a positive voltage is applied to the anode with respect to the cathode, it allows current to flow in the forward direction, effectively converting AC to DC.
The 1N4005GPHM3/54 is widely used in various applications such as: - Power supplies - Battery chargers - Voltage regulators - Rectifiers in electronic equipment
Some alternative models to the 1N4005GPHM3/54 include: - 1N4001 - 1N4002 - 1N4003 - 1N4004 - 1N4006 - 1N4007
